NORMAL, Ill. -
For the eighth-straight year, Illinois State Athletics will host the "Taste of Redbirds" event in Horton Field House between the Illinois State-Missouri State basketball doubleheader Saturday, Feb. 12, on Doug Collins Court at Redbird Arena.
This year's "Taste of Redbirds" will be held from 4:30-6:30 p.m., between the two games. The day will begin at 1:05 p.m., when the women's team hosts the Bears in their PINK game to support the Kay Yow Cancer Fund. Fans will then have a chance to sample food and fun, before heading back to Redbird Arena for a 7:05 p.m. tipoff for the men's game against the Bears.
Admission to the event is free, but tickets need to be purchased for the food and beverages (while supplies last), which will be provided by Bloomington-Normal-area restaurants and vendors. Participating vendors include Alexander's Steakhouse, Avanti's, Bandana's Bar-B-Q, Beer Nuts, Buffalo Wild Wings, Denny's Doughnuts, Doubletree Hotel, DP Dough, Famous Dave's, Jimmy John's, Moe's Southwest Grill, and Times Past Inn.
In addition, the Reggie Fun Zone will be set up in the field house, which will include inflatables and a climbing wall from Upper Limits. The Alamo II will also be on hand with discounted Redbird merchandise for sale and the ISU pep band will make an appearance just prior to 6:30 p.m.
